Transaction 376376068fd35c3296eab0d6ecedf37f89c60246c5cbd1a82f65067e63780cd9
1 Input
1 Output
-
376376068fd35c3296eab0d6ecedf37f89c60246c5cbd1a82f65067e63780cd9:0
- value
- 28648006
- script pubkey
- OP_0 OP_PUSHBYTES_20 96fdbef4bd0b218f1876e55976c73d38f2d51214
- address
- bc1qjm7maa9apvsc7xrku4vhd3ea8red2ys5d0espr